check voltage at alternator and compare readings. You may have bad connections or bad wire from alt to battery. Usual drill, clean connections etc, try again, compare readings to get voltage drop. alistair
On 3-Feb-11, at 10:43 AM, Don Hanson wrote: > My bosch alternator, a rebuild just a few years old, is giving me > 13.10 > +/- volts at the passenger side (starter) battery terminals. I am > thinking > "new Voltage regulator"...right? When I add rpms or load (turn on > headlights) nothing much changes with the voltage. anyone care to > comment > or confirm that another regulator is the 'right stuff?" > > Don Hanson |
